Introducing **Art and Faith: A Theology of Making**, a profound exploration that synthesizes the intersection of creativity and spirituality. This enlightening book invites you to reflect on the imaginative act of creation through a theological lens. By engaging with the works of artists, theologians, and creative thinkers, it ultimately encourages readers to embrace their innate gifts and use them as expressions of faith.

What is the main theme of this book?

The main theme revolves around the intersection of art and theology, exploring how making art can be an expression of faith.

Who is the target audience for this book?

The book is aimed at artists, theologians, and anyone interested in the relationship between creativity and spirituality.

Can this book be used in educational settings?

Yes, it provides valuable insights for theology and art courses, making it a great resource for students and educators alike.

What makes this book unique compared to others?

It uniquely blends artistic practice with theological reflection, emphasizing the role of creativity in spiritual life.

Are there exercises or practical applications in the book?

Yes, it includes practical ways for readers to engage with their faith through art.
